A Note on Solving Problems of Substantially Super-linear Complexity in Rounds of the Congested Clique

arXiv:2405.15270

Abstract

We study the possibility of designing -round protocols for problems of substantially super-linear polynomial-time (sequential) complexity on the congested clique with about nodes, where is the input size. We show that the average time complexity of the local computation performed at a clique node (in terms of the size of the data received by the node) in such protocols has to be substantially larger than the time complexity of the given problem.
